Easy Crockpot Velveeta Creamy Chicken Dinner

Ingredients 🛒

  • 2 lbs boneless skinless chicken breasts or chicken thighs
  • 1 large block Velveeta cheese (about 32 oz), cubed
  • 1 block cream cheese (8 oz), softened
  • 1 can cream of chicken soup (10.5 oz)
  • 1 cup chicken broth
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on onion powder
  • ½ teaspoon black pepper
  • ½ teaspoon paprika (optional)
  • 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ese (optional for extra richness)
  • 12 oz pasta shells, egg noodles, or rice (for serving)
  • Fresh parsley for garnish (optional)

Instructions 👩‍🍳

  1. Prepare the crockpot
    Lightly grease the crockpot or slow cooker with cooking spray.
  2. Add the chicken
    Place the chicken breasts or thighs in the bottom of the crockpot.
  3. Add creamy ingredients
    Pour the cream of chicken soup and chicken broth over the chicken.
  4. Add cheeses
    Cube the Velveeta and place it on top of the chicken. Add the cream cheese in chunks.
  5. Season
    Sprinkle garlic powder, onion powder, paprika, and black pepper over everything.
  6. Cook slowly
    Cover and cook:
    • Low: 6–7 hours
    • High: 3–4 hours
  7. Shred the chicken
    Once the chicken is tender, shred it using two forks and stir it into the creamy sauce.
  8. Add optional cheddar
    Stir in shredded cheddar cheese if you want an even cheesier flavor.
  9. Serve
    Serve hot over cooked pasta, rice, or mashed potatoes.

Cooking Methods 🍲

1. Slow Cooker Method (Best)

Cook on low for 6–7 hours for the richest flavor and tender chicken.

2. Instant Pot Method

  • Cook chicken with soup and broth on High Pressure for 12 minutes.
  • Release pressure, add cheeses, and stir until melted.

3. Stovetop Method

  • Cook chicken pieces in a large pot.
  • Add soup, broth, and cheeses.
  • Simmer until melted and creamy.

History of the Dish 📜

Creamy slow-cooker meals like this became popular in the 1950s–1970s in American home kitchens, when convenient ingredients like canned soups and processed cheese were widely used.

Velveeta cheese was introduced in 1918 and became famous for its smooth melting texture, making it perfect for casseroles, dips, and crockpot meals.

Today, recipes like this remain favorites because they are easy, comforting, and family-friendly.
